    What is Spaghetti Aglio Olio e Peperoncino?

    Spaghetti Aglio Olio e Peperoncino is a classic Italian pasta dish that comes from southern Italy, particularly Naples. It’s a simple yet flavorful recipe made with just a few pantry staples—extra virgin olive oil, fresh garlic, red pepper flakes, and pasta al dente.

    The garlic is gently sautéed in olive oil until golden brown, releasing its rich aroma, while the red pepper flakes add a subtle yet spicy kick. Tossed together with perfectly cooked spaghetti and a splash of pasta water, the ingredients create a silky, garlicky oil-based sauce that coats every strand of pasta.

    Often finished with fresh parsley and, optionally, a sprinkle of pecorino cheese or toasted breadcrumbs, this dish is a staple of Italian food. It’s quick, comforting, and packed with bold flavors—all with minimal effort.

    🥘 Ingredients

    Spaghetti Aglio Olio e Peperoncino ingredients.
    • Extra Virgin Olive Oil: The foundation of this dish, high-quality olive oil infuses the pasta with rich, garlicky flavor. Look for the best quality oil you can find for a smooth, well-balanced taste.
    • Fresh Garlic: Minced garlic gently sautéed in olive oil creates the bold, aromatic base of the sauce. Be sure to cook it over medium-low heat to achieve a golden brown color without burning.
    • Red Pepper Flakes: These spicy red pepper flakes add just the right amount of heat, balancing the dish with a subtle kick. Adjust the amount to your spice preference for the best result. You can also opt to finely dice a red chile pepper - especially if you like spicy food. 
    • Spaghetti: The classic pasta for this recipe, spaghetti’s smooth surface perfectly holds the garlicky oil. Cook it until just al dente for the ideal texture. If needed, bucatini or linguine can work as substitutes.
    • Salt: A pinch of salt enhances the flavors of the olive oil and garlic while seasoning the pasta water. Be mindful if adding cheese later, as it can also add saltiness.
    • Fresh Parsley: Chopped fresh parsley adds a bright, herbaceous finish, complementing the richness of the olive oil and the heat from the red pepper flakes.
    • Reserved Pasta Water: This starchy cup of pasta water helps emulsify the sauce, creating a silky, well-coated final dish. Add it gradually to achieve the perfect consistency.

    🔪 Step by Step Instructions

    Boil the Pasta: Bring a large pot of water to a rolling boil then add salt. Add the spaghetti and cook for 1 minute less than the package instructions for pasta al dente. Reserve ½ cup of pasta water before draining.

    spaghetti in boiling water.

    Infuse the Olive Oil: Heat a large skillet over medium-low heat and add extra virgin olive oil. Once warm, add the minced fresh garlic and red pepper flakes. Cook gently, stirring occasionally, until the garlic turns golden brown and fragrant, being careful not to let it burn.

    garlic red pepper flakes and salt in olive oil.

    Combine Pasta and Sauce: Transfer the cooked spaghetti directly into the skillet with the garlic-infused oil. Add ½ cup of reserved pasta water and toss vigorously over medium-high heat, allowing the sauce to emulsify and coat the pasta evenly.

    cooked spaghetti added to olive oil and garlic sauce.

    Finish with Fresh Parsley: Remove from heat and stir in the fresh parsley. If desired, drizzle in a bit more extra virgin olive oil for a richer finish.

    parsley added to pasta.

    Serve Immediately: Divide the spaghetti aglio olio e peperoncino into bowls and enjoy while hot with a sprinkle of Parmesan Cheese or Muddica Atturrata. Buon appetito!

    👩🏼‍🍳 Tips & Notes

    • Cook the garlic over medium-low heat and stir frequently to ensure it turns a perfect golden brown without burning. Burnt garlic can add a bitter flavor, so keep a close eye on it for the best result!
    • Always reserve a cup of pasta water before draining—this starchy liquid is key to creating a silky, emulsified sauce that clings to the pasta.
    • Use high quality extra virgin olive oil you can find, as it’s the backbone of this dish and greatly impacts the flavor.

    📖 Substitutions & Variations

    Spicy Swap: If red pepper flakes aren’t available, finely chop a fresh chili pepper for a vibrant, spicier kick that still stays true to the dish’s essence.

    Pasta Alternatives: Don’t have spaghetti? Use bucatini, linguine, or even fresh pasta for a unique twist while maintaining the classic Italian feel.

    Hearty Addition: For a more filling meal, toss in sautéed shrimp or grilled chicken—these proteins pair beautifully with the garlicky, spicy flavors.

    💭 Recipe FAQs

    Can I make Spaghetti Aglio Olio e Peperoncino ahead of time?

    Yes, but this dish is best enjoyed fresh. The sauce relies on the silky emulsification of pasta water and olive oil, which can lose its texture when reheated. If you must prepare it ahead, store the pasta and sauce separately in airtight containers. When ready to serve, toss them together in a skillet with a splash of reserved pasta water or extra olive oil to refresh the sauce.

    🥣 Storage & Reheating

    If you have leftovers, allow the pasta to cool completely before transferring it to an airtight container. Store it in the refrigerator for up to 3 days.

    To reheat, place the pasta in a skillet over medium heat with a splash of water or extra virgin olive oil to loosen the sauce. Toss gently until warmed through. Avoid microwaving, as it may dry out the pasta and alter the flavor of the sauce.

    Ingredients
      

    • 1 pound dried spaghetti
    • Salt for pasta water
    • ½ cup extra-virgin olive oil
    • 6 cloves garlic minced
    • 1 teaspoon crushed red pepper flakes or to taste
    • ½ cup reserved pasta water
    • ½ cup chopped parsley
    Get Recipe Ingredients
    Prevent your screen from going dark

    Instructions
     

    • Cook the pasta: Bring a large pot of generously salted water to a boil. Add the spaghetti and cook for 1 minute less than the package instructions for al dente.
    • Prepare the sauce: Place a large skillet over medium-low heat. Add the olive oil, minced garlic, red pepper flakes, and a pinch of salt. Cook slowly, stirring occasionally, until the garlic is fragrant and the oil is infused. Avoid browning the garlic.
    • Combine pasta and sauce: Transfer the spaghetti directly to the skillet using tongs, along with ½ cup of reserved pasta water. Turn the heat to medium-high and toss the pasta continuously for 1 to 2 minutes, until the sauce thickens and coats the pasta.
    • Finish and serve: Stir in the chopped parsley and, if desired, drizzle with additional olive oil. Serve immediately.
